I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Gloria Mae
Beaver
November 17, 1930 – December 20, 2024
Gloria Mae Beaver left this world peacefully to be with God on December 20, 2024, at the age of 94. She was born on November 17,1930 in Poynette, Wisconsin to Martha (Zechel) and Daniel Smith. She was the "apple of her mama and papa's eye" being the last born of 8 children. Mom graduated Valedictorian of her Poynette HS class of 1948. She worked for many years as a waitress at The Owl's Nest in Poynette until 1964 when she and her children moved to Mazomanie.
Mom's life was filled with many great loves, most notably her deep faith, being a longtime member of The Mazomanie United Church of Christ, having served as financial secretary, Sunday school teacher, pianist as well as singing in the choir.
She had many interests but dear to her heart was bird watching. She fed and watched them, admiring their many colors and calls. Early on, along with playing the piano, mom played numerous other musical instruments of which included the clarinet, accordion and marimba. It was her love and appreciation of music that led her to find the "love of her life" musician Ivan "Buzz" Beaver and in 1970 they married. Together they shared their love of music, outdoors and travel with their children camping throughout the United States on family vacations.
Other interests were planting vegetables and flowers, always making sure to grow milkweed to promote monarch butterfly visits, baking and cross-stitching and looked forward to her weekly get-together with her card playing friends. She had the patience of a saint and was a master at crossword puzzles, cryptoquote, "Jeopardy," and "The Wheel." Mom loved her Wisconsin sports teams, always cheering on the Badgers, Brewers, Packers and her beloved Bucks!
